Hyderabad: Telangana EAGLE Force, in coordination with local police, busted an interstate drug trafficking network operating between Rajasthan and Hyderabad and arrested seven persons in two cases on Friday.
Police seized 1.031 kg of opium worth Rs 5.15 lakh and 25 grams of mephedrone valued at Rs 7.5 lakh, along with other material.
In the Miyapur case, three persons were arrested, and police identified Mahender Kumawath of Rajasthan as a key supplier. The alleged trafficking network was reportedly operating near a school, raising concerns over the safety of students.
In the Saifabad case, four Rajasthan natives were arrested while allegedly delivering MD. Police identified Harinder Devda of Jalore as an alleged kingpin. Police officials said they intercepted 78 Rajasthan-linked drug trafficking attempts since 2023. Efforts are on to trace suppliers, financiers, transporters and local peddlers.
